just want to point out that you do NOT need to wait for the physical nimbus card to come through the post to link it to merlin. all you need is your application ID which is on a email when nimbus approves your application. can be linked right there and then
Maybe this is true however, that was not my experience (I did not even receive an approval email - It just arrived through the post) but thanks for the update.
I guess the main reason for the video is to ensure people pre book RAP because I have seen many guests turned away on the day.
@axlandsean when you apply with nimbus. You get a acceptance email. To say it is now live. And on that email there is a application ID. You use that to then link it to Merlin. It was like this 3 years ago. And again a few weeks ago.
Do all the rides have a place to store a small bag before getting on the ride? I have medical equipment which can be put into a locker.
@@zorbathegreek192 Yes, all rides have a baggage hold. Most have a 'cloak room' type where you hand your bag over in the queue line and they give you a wristband with a number on it which you collect at the exit of the ride. Others have a standard baggage hold in the ride station.

So hold on, let’s say the queue line is 4 hours long for Nemesis, you get to ride it without queuing, but you wouldn’t be able to ride oblivion till 4 hours later?? Or is it you can’t ride nemesis for 4 hours? If that’s the case, that’s a bit unfair because you go on a ride and then sit around for 4 hours until the next ride which for someone who suffers ADHD or Autism for example cannot do.
Correct: for example if a queue line is 2 hours and you enter the ride at 10am, they would put 12pm for the next time you can ride an attraction however sometimes they can be more lenient. I guess it depends on the day. This is the same across all Merlin theme parks (in the UK at least anyway).
